BOAT TOUR to discover Salento

The Boat Tour offers the possibility of making a short boat tour of the internal Marina and reaching the other part of the city.
After crossing the port by boat, it will be possible to walk to the spectacular Monument to the Sailor of Brindisi and the picturesque Fishermen Village of the city.
The Monument to the Sailor of Brindisi, represents the most important and imposing historical monumental structure of the city.
It has a rudder shape and was made of reinforced concrete covered with a golden colored stone.
Once reached the summit, at a height of 53 meters, it will be possible to admire a panoramic view of the port and the city.
We will then proceed on foot, reaching the characteristic Fishermen Village of Brindisi, a historic corner of the city where Salento traditions and culture still offer magical landscapes.
Afterwards we leave by boat to reach the other part of the city again (place of departure).

Itinerary
This is a typical itinerary for this product

Stop At: Colonne Terminali della Via Appia, Via Colonne Porto di Brindisi, Brindisi Italy

We will reach the Roman Columns to discover the end of the Appian Way.
From this strategic location, you can also admire the beauty of the Marina, the Alfonsino Castle at sea and the other part of the city.

Duration: 10 minutes

Stop At: Monumento al Marinaio d'Italia, Viale Duca degli Abruzzi, 72100 Brindisi Italy

Once out of the boat, we will walk to the Monument to the Sailor of Brindisi, which certainly represents the main symbol of the city.
The structure is rudder-shaped and made of reinforced concrete completely covered in stone.
The Monument to the Sailor was created to commemorate the approximately 6,000 sailors who fell during the First World War (1915-1918).
From the height of its 53 meters it will be possible to follow it and explore it until it reaches the highest part for a fantastic panoramic view of the city.


Duration: 55 minutes

Stop At: Villaggio del Pescatore, Villaggio del Pescatore, Duino, Province of Trieste, Friuli Venezia Giulia

During the walking tour we will see the picturesque '' Fishermen's Village of Brindisi '' designed by Ing. Ugo DÂ’Alonzo in 1938, to welcome the people of the Sciabiche marine district, on the opposite shore of the western side.
The Fishermen Village of Brindisi represents a piece of Brindisi tradition that often becomes folklore.
It will be possible to see the characteristic fishermen's houses and their local activities in a corner of the city where time seems to have stopped.
Very interesting to observe the fishermen in their activity of production and repair of the "sciabbiche" the traditional fishing nets characteristic of the maritime tradition of Brindisi.



Duration: 30 minutes
